REally all you have to do is unscrew 2 little bolts and unplug the electric connectors then bring them into the warm dry house or use a hair dryer to remove the moisture. Finally make sure the rear bulb access cover rubber is clean and makes a good seal.

You don't have to buy new ones!!!!
